Only At the Barricade
Only at the barricade
Shall our scores be settled
Only at the barricade
Shall they hearken to our cry
Only at the barricade
Shall our strength be more strengthened
Only at the barricade
Shall they be forced to shiver and quiver
Only at the barricade
Shall they handover our hangover
Only at the barricade
Shall the slaves look straight into the eyes of their masters
Only at the barricade
Shall their quest for dialogue be meaningful
Only at the barricade
Shall we be able to swim in freedom
Only at the barricade
Shall we take over and possess our possession.
Alayande Stephen Tolulope
